Exploring Ward Township, Tioga County, PA: Community and Automotive Landscape
Ward Township, situated in Tioga County, Pennsylvania, recorded a population of 223 at the 2020 census, highlighting its status as a rural and less densely populated area. Covering a significant area of 34.2 square miles, much of the township is encompassed by the Tioga State Forest. For its residents, personal vehicles are not just a convenience but a necessity for navigating the distances and accessing services in this part of Northern Pennsylvania.
Local Spots and Their Transportation Needs
Ward Township's defining feature is largely its natural landscape, with much of it being part of the Tioga State Forest. This vast forest offers op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, hunting, and fishing, primarily accessed by personal vehicles capable of handling potentially unpaved or less maintained roads. The ghost town of Fall Brook, located within the state forest, is a point of historical interest, though reaching it would likely require a personal vehicle suited for rural travel. Given the absence of significant commercial centers within the township itself, residents rely on travel to neighboring townships like Sullivan, Union, Hamilton, and Covington, and larger boroughs like Wellsboro and Mansfield, for everyday needs such as grocery shopping, healthcare, and employment. The distances between residences and these service centers necessitate reliable personal transportation.
